The OSKKK Methodology
See on Scoop.it – lean manufacturing
The author of this PDF document, Greg Lane, “learned this simple method while working for Toyota. There is nothing profound in these simple ideas…”
OSKKK stands for the following:
- Observe
- Standardize materials, motions, tasks and management.
- Kaizen 1 – Improve information and materials flow and process
- Kaizen 2 – Improve equipment
- Kaizen 3 – Improve layout

Hospitals look to Toyota automaker for efficient operating rooms
See on Scoop.it – lean manufacturing
More about TPS in health care in Canada, this time about SMED applied to operating room turnarounds. This is not the first time manufacturing techniques cross over to surgery: 100 years ago, through motion studies in operating rooms, industrial engineers Frank and Lillian Gilbreth developed the method by which nurses make tools immediately available to surgeons.
“Surgeons are using Toyota management techniques to cut time between surgeries and halve overtime hours…”
